Present perfect continuous 13

Esercizio 13

Inserisci la forma corretta del present perfect continuous

Inserisci le paole mancanti, poi premi il tasto "Controlla" per verificare le tue risposte.
You (walk) along the river all afternoon.
They (talk) for more than two hours.
Tom (dance) with Bella all night.
We (cycle) all afternoon.
You (drive) home since 5 am.
John (collaborate) with him in producing the film since last year.
We (dive) from beautiful rocks since this morning.
John and Anita (play) tennis since 5 pm.
They (take) the children to the park all morning.
You (cut) the grass all afternoon.
